1.
WHAT [INVENTED NAME] IS AND WHAT IT IS USED FOR
[Invented name] is a medicine to lower increased levels of
cholesterol. [Invented name] contains
ezetimibe and atorvastatin.
[Invented name] is used in adults to lower levels of total
cholesterol, “bad” cholesterol (LDL
cholesterol), and fatty substances called triglycerides in the blood.
In addition, [Invented name] raises
levels of “good” cholesterol (HDL cholesterol).
[Invented name] works to reduce your cholesterol in two ways. It
reduces the cholesterol absorbed in
your digestive tract, as well as the cholesterol your body makes by
itself.
Cholesterol is one of several fatty substances found in the
bloodstream. Your total cholesterol is made
up mainly of LDL and HDL cholesterol.
LDL cholesterol is often called “bad” cholesterol because it can
build up in the walls of your arteries
forming plaque. Eventually this plaque build-up can lead to a

Excipients with known effect
Each 10 mg/ 10 mg tablet contains 145 mg lactose.
Each 10 mg/ 20 mg tablet contains 170 mg lactose.
Each 10 mg/ 40 mg tablet contains 219 mg lactose.
Each 10 mg/ 80 mg tablet contains 317 mg lactose.
For the full list of excipients, see section 6.1.

4.
CLINICAL PARTICULARS
4.1
THERAPEUTIC INDICATIONS
[Invented name] as an adjunct to diet is indicated as substitution
therapy for treatment of adults with
primary (heterozygous and homozygous familial and non-familal)
hypercholesterolaemia or mixed
hyperlipidaemia already controlled with atorvastatin and ezetimibe
given concurrently at the same
dose level.
4.2
POSOLOGY AND METHOD OF ADMINISTRATION
Posology
The recommended dose of [Invented name] is 1 tablet per day.
The maximum recommended dose of [Invented name] is 10 mg/80 mg per
day.
The patient should be on an appropriate lipid lowering diet and should
continue on this diet during
treatment with [Invented name].
